  • If you seek a name that embodies both strength and grace, look no further than Oakleigh. With English origins, Oakleigh is a timeless choice that draws inspiration from nature's wonders. The name Oakleigh finds its roots in the Old English words "oak" and "leigh," meaning "clearing" or "meadow." The mighty oak tree, renowned for its solidity and longevity, lends its attributes to the name, symbolizing resilience and stability. Additionally, the association with a tranquil meadow evokes a sense of peace and serenity.
